Chapter 2. Adding Text to Your Web Pages

True broadband Internet media like streaming video, audio, and high-quality graphics continue to grab the headlines. After all, it's exciting to speculate about the Web replacing your telephone, or tapping your keyboard to get movies on demand.

But the Web is primarily woven with words. Steven King novellas, Sony PlayStation 2 reviews, and the latest gossip on J. Lo still drive people to the Web. As you build Web pages and Web sites, you'll spend a lot of your time adding and formatting text. Understanding how Dreamweaver works with text is vital to getting your message across effectively.

This chapter covers the not-always-simple act of getting text into your Dreamweaver documents. In Chapter 3, you can read about formatting this text so that it looks professionally designed.
